Yellow Rattle Plug Plants (Rhinanthus minor)

This surprisingly musical meadow flower is a must-get for a wildflower garden: as a semi-parasitic plant, it requires robust neighbour plants like grasses and legumes, but also acts as a watchdog against vigorous weeds... and that's on top of the beauty of its golden, bell-shaped flowers, complete with a charming 'chime' as its ripened seed pods rattle in the breeze.

Our yellow rattle plug plants are grown from fresh, UK native seed from wild meadow collections, and arrive ready to be planted complete with the essential meadow grasses.

  • Type: Annual
  • Height: 20–50cm. 
  • Flowers: May-September
  • Soil Requirement: Moist or well-drained
  • Light Requirement: Full sun
  • Natural Habitat: Grassland, meadows
  • Also known as: Corn Rattle, Hay Rattle, Penny Grass

Although similar in looks to the stinging nettle, Red Deadnettle has harmless, heart-shaped foliage with a purple tint. As an early-blooming plant, these whorls of hooded flowers in ruby red to pinkish-purple are a prominent source of early pollen for bees as they build up their nest.

  • Type: Annual
  • Height: 5-30cm.
  • Flowers: March - October
  • Soil requirement: Moist
  • Light requirement: Full sun, partial shade
  • Natural habitat: Waste grounds, field edges, roadside verges
  • Also known as: Purple Deadnettle, Purple Archangel

Wildflower plants are an especially popular choice for those looking to quickly add some biodiversity to their garden. A wildflower garden, even in just a small area, creates a rich habitat for insects and other wildlife. Many wildflowers provide a valuable source of food for pollinators, such as bees - so not only will you have a beautiful garden, you’ll have a helpful one.
